Low Carb Protein Cookies for a Healthy Treat (These are the best!) 3 tbsp or to taste granulated Stevia or other low carb granulated sweetener Preheat oven to 350°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Place the protein powder, coconut flour, baking soda in a bowl and mix to combine.
Place the protein powder, coconut flour, baking soda in a bowl and mix to combine. Add the peanut butter, sweetener, egg and egg white and mix to combine. Drop the dough by the tablespoon onto the prepared baking sheet. Flatten the cookies, using a fork, in a criss-cross pattern. Bake for 8-12 minutes or until edges of cookies have browned.
